Integration of Earth observation with the E-NUNDATION solution

activity - Thu, 26/09/2024 - 10:57

"Flooding is the most frequent and damaging natural disaster in Canada. Every year, floods cause more than 1 billion dollar in damage. These costs are expected to triple by 2030 due to climate change. The development of knowledge and the preparation regarding these risks among  governments, Insurance compnies, and the general public are among the biggest challenges related to this issue.

Satellite-Derived Bathymetry and Shoal Detection for Safer Navigation

activity - Thu, 26/09/2024 - 10:46

This project aims to lower the cost and improve the accuracy of satellite-derived bathymetry, across the full range of shallow waters found on Earth. The primary impact will be to improve safety of navigation, reducing the risk of accidents from grounding and its resulting marine pollution, as well as lower fuel costs and CO2 emissions from marine transportation.

Snow Water Equivalent Estimation for Flooding Warning Using Deep Learning Based Segmentation and InSAR Technologies Utilizing RCM CP Data

activity - Wed, 25/09/2024 - 17:45

Smart use of satellite data to develop solutions to key challenges on Earth and in our everyday lives. 

The project aims to develop a technology that can provide a reliable estimation of snow water equivalent for monitoring and forecasting of potential snowmelt flood events through utilizing RADARSAT Constellation Mission data.

Towards a Remote Sensing Evapotranspiration and Consumptive Use Water Reporting Tool for Canada

activity - Wed, 25/09/2024 - 17:25

Canada is water rich. It contains 7% of the world’s renewable freshwater. Considering the central importance of water to Canada’s economy and the increasing pressures on our water systems, better water management is crucial for Canada’s current and future economic and environmental security.
